Strauss Wind Farm is a 95.3 MW wind power plant located in Santa Barbara County, California. The facility, owned and operated by Strauss Wind LLC, commenced operations in 2023. It utilizes a single generator consisting of onshore wind turbines. The plant is interconnected to the California Independent System Operator (CAISO) balancing authority within the Western Electricity Coordinating Council (WECC) NERC region.
The wind farm's turbines have a hub height of 81.5 meters and a rotor diameter of 137 meters. The turbines were manufactured by GE Wind, model GE3.83-137. In its most recent year of operation, Strauss Wind Farm generated 224,256 MWh of electricity, achieving a capacity factor of 26.9%. The plant ranks 30th out of 116 wind facilities in California and 771st out of 1424 nationally.
